Bloodthirsty Conqueror, creature, black, 5/5, flying, deathtouch.
“When your opponent loses life: you gain that much life. This effect can trigger up to 4 time(s) per turn.”
Does Losing life include combat damage? Spell damage? So far It has not triggered for me while playing any events with the alternative art Card.
Or am I mistaken? Does it have to litterally be life taken by cards with the phrase “your opponent loses # life”?
@MtgHue It has to be an effect that specifies life loss. Any kind if damage doesn’t count as life loss and won’t trigger it.
